Standard Normal Distribution
The standard normal distribution is a normal distribution with a mean of 0 and a standard deviation of 1, used in probability theory to represent real-valued random variables with unknown distributions.
Mean
The average of a set of numbers, calculated by dividing the sum of these numbers by the count of the numbers.
Standard Deviation
A measure of the amount of variation or dispersion of a set of values, indicating how much the values in the data set differ from the mean.
Standard Normal Random Variable
A random variable with a mean of 0 and a standard deviation of 1 under the normal distribution.
